Imagine a world where the heroes of your childhood exist not just in fiction, but as an aspirational reality. For Tanzaburo Tojima, a 40-year-old construction worker, that reality is Kamen Rider. This beloved franchise takes an intriguing turn in Tojima Wants to Be a Kamen Rider, a manga-turned-anime that explores the fervent desires of adults who long to embody their masked heroes in a world suddenly facing real-life “Shocker” threats. Episode 10, titled “Risking Your Life,” delivers a powerful and unexpected showdown that delves deep into the essence of what it truly means to be a Kamen Rider.

The Premise of Tojima Wants to Be a Kamen Rider

Tojima Wants to Be a Kamen Rider is a Japanese manga series penned and illustrated by Yokusaru Shibata, with official cooperation from Toei Company and Ishimori Productions, making it an authentic spinoff of the iconic Kamen Rider franchise. The story centers on Tanzaburo Tojima, a man who, despite turning 40, steadfastly holds onto his childhood dream of becoming a Kamen Rider. His secluded physical training takes an unexpected turn when he learns of a crime wave perpetrated by individuals mimicking the villainous organization “Shocker,” reigniting his desire to become a true hero. An anime television series adaptation, produced by Liden Films, premiered in October 2025, bringing Tojima’s heartfelt journey to a global audience.

Episode 10: “Risking Your Life” Overview

Episode 10, officially titled “Risking Your Life” (命を懸けるの, Inochi wo Kakeru no), aired on December 7, 2025, in Japan and December 6, 2025, on Crunchyroll. This installment is a pivotal part of a tournament arc within the series, focusing intensely on the third match: a fierce contest between Tanzaburo Tojima and Yuriko Okada. The episode not only showcases intense action but also serves as a profound character study, exploring the psychological and emotional depths that drive these adult fans to embody their chosen heroes.

A Clash of Ideologies: Tojima vs. Yuriko

The central conflict of “Risking Your Life” is the battle between Tojima and Yuriko. Both are dedicated to their Kamen Rider ideals, but they approach the concept from different angles:

Tojima’s Unyielding Power and Belief

Tojima’s strength is described as purely physical and raw. He has spent years honing his body through heavy labor and mimicking the moves of the original Kamen Rider show, rather than formal martial arts training. His power stems from an unextinguishable fire in his heart – a profound belief that when he wears his mask, he is Kamen Rider. This conviction allows him to push his body far beyond normal human limits, demonstrating an otherworldly endurance. He embodies the Rider’s spirit of never giving up and never retreating, even when physically battered. His “Rider Punch” is depicted as incredibly powerful, capable of knocking down even monstrous foes.

Yuriko’s Skill, Devotion, and Breakthrough

Yuriko Okada, a 24-year-old high school teacher, grew up admiring Electro-Wave Human Tackle from Kamen Rider Stronger. Unlike Tojima, Yuriko is a skilled fighter with actual martial arts and wrestling training, making her a far more technical combatant. Initially, she struggles against Tojima’s sheer resilience, feeling like an “ineffective glass cannon” against his relentless assault.

A pivotal moment for Yuriko in this episode is her emotional breakthrough regarding Tackle’s death in Kamen Rider Stronger. She had long held frustration over Tackle’s sacrifice, and unleashing this bottled-up emotion allows her to unlock a deeper level of power. She realizes that, like Tojima channeling Kamen Rider, she too can embody the spirit of Tackle, driven by her profound love for the character.

The Power of Belief: Channeling the Riders

Episode 10 highlights a core theme of the series: the power of belief in manifesting heroic abilities. Both Tojima and Yuriko’s fighting capabilities seem to transcend normal human limits not through supernatural means, but through an intense psychological identification with their idols. Tojima’s unwavering conviction that he is Kamen Rider allows him to endure incredible punishment and deliver devastating blows. Similarly, Yuriko’s realization that her love for Tackle can be a source of strength enables her to “embody Tackle” and fight with renewed determination, even seemingly mimicking some of Tackle’s signature electrical attacks. The episode strongly suggests that the depth of one’s belief and love for the Kamen Rider spirit is what truly enables these individuals to become heroes in their own right.

The Unexpected Outcome and Future Implications

“Risking Your Life” culminates in a surprising and emotionally charged finish. Despite Tojima’s relentless determination and seemingly unbreakable spirit, Yuriko manages to achieve victory. After pushing Tojima to his absolute limits, with both combatants bleeding and their masks shattered, Yuriko delivers a decisive blow, reportedly a “double armed DDT variant” or an “electric wave throw,” that knocks Tojima out.

This outcome is significant for several reasons:

  • Subversion of Expectations: Many viewers expected Tojima, as the titular character and seemingly the physically strongest, to dominate the tournament. Yuriko’s win demonstrates that genuine belief, combined with skill and emotional resolve, can overcome raw power.
  • Yuriko’s Growth: This victory is a major character development for Yuriko, validating her dedication to Tackle and her own heroic aspirations. She moves on to the finals of the tournament, where she is set to face Mitsuba (Rider Man).
  • Tojima’s Resilience: Even in defeat, Tojima’s unwavering spirit is emphasized. A humorous post-credits scene shows that he can only be revived by having his Kamen Rider mask placed back on him, underscoring that his identity and power are intrinsically linked to his heroic persona.

Episode 10 of Tojima Wants to Be a Kamen Rider is hailed as one of the best episodes of the series, not just for its action, but for its deep exploration of character, conviction, and the profound impact of heroism. It solidifies the show’s unique take on the Kamen Rider legacy, proving that the heart of a hero can burn brightly in anyone who truly believes.
